Russell Dalgleish Steps Down from the Board

The Asia Scotland Institute has announced that Russell Dalgleish has stepped off its Board owing to pressures of other activities, especially his involvement with the Scottish Business Network. “Russell has made a significant contribution whilst on the Board. Although stepping down he has made it very clear that he will continue to support the important work of the Institute in building bridges with Asian countries and the Scottish diaspora.” – Roddy Gow, Founder and Chairman

University of Dundee – Award Ceremony

Congratulations to Alistair Mitchell and Thomas Carlyle for winning the Asia Scotland Institute prize for Best Performing Students in International Capital Markets at the University of Dundee‘s award ceremony. Roddy Gow OBE, Chairman and Founder of the Asia Scotland Institute, presented the prizes and highlighted our commitment to inspiring the leaders of tomorrow by promoting a greater understanding of Asia through the sharing of knowledge.

Tribute to Shinzo Abe

The Chairman and Board of the Asia Scotland Institute express their deep sorrow at the news of the tragic and utterly terrible assassination of former Prime Minister Shinzo Abe. On behalf of the Institute, we extend our deepest condolences to the Japanese people and recognise Mr Abe’s very great contribution to economic growth and the pursuit of global peace. An outstanding statesman, he played a major role in repositioning Japan as a world player and leading economy and his contributions will be sorely missed.
